The Statute of Limitations

The statute of limitations or deadline in each state will determine when victims are able to file claims. They'll lose their right to compensation if they fail to file. A mesothelioma lawyer can help victims determine if they have enough time to file their lawsuit.

The time limit for a claim varies according to the state and the type of asbestos claim. Personal injury lawsuits and trust fund claims come with different time limits. For example, some states allow only two years to file a mesothelioma suit while some allow six. Mesothelioma attorneys can often help victims get extensions or exceptions from the statute of limitation.

Asbestos exposure often occurs over many years. In the majority of cases the victim won't be aware of the harm until much later. The time between diagnosis and treatment for mesothelioma can range from 40 to 60 years. Asbestos law experts say that is why most states follow the "discovery rule" for asbestos exposure cases. The discovery rule allows for the limitation period to begin when the victim discovers or should have realized they suffered from a health condition caused by asbestos.

Some states also have a statute for asbestos claims. A statute of repose functions like a statute of limitations, except it starts to run from the date of asbestos exposure instead of the date of diagnosis.

Preparation

The mesothelioma litigation [click through the following web page] process can be daunting, especially since symptoms may not appear for 20 to 50 years. A legal claim can help patients and their families receive compensation for medical expenses, lost wages and pain and suffering associated with mesothelioma.

A skilled mesothelioma lawyer can help victims navigate the legal process and ensure they receive the highest possible amount. The process starts with filing a claim, which includes the mesothelioma diagnosis and a listing of damages sought.

Then, the defendants are given a chance to reply. This phase of the case involves gathering more information and could include a recorded deposition with your lawyer present. Most often, mesothelioma lawyers as well as the defendants will try to settle the case during this period. This avoids the defendants the expense of the trial as well as the chance of a negative verdict from a jury.

If a settlement is not reached, the case will move to the discovery stage in which your attorneys as well as the defendants' attorneys will gather evidence on both sides of the dispute. The defendants will also be questioned questions during this stage that can take a few months to finish. You and your lawyer must be prepared for this phase of the process, since you may be asked questions about your work history, locations where asbestos exposure occurred, and whether you or a family member was exposed to the substance by indirect means.
